Make your own dishes at this cool Noodle joint
Tag: miranda
The Italian Kitchen, Sydney
A slice of Modern Italy amongst some drool-worthy shops
Make your own dishes at this cool Noodle joint
A slice of Modern Italy amongst some drool-worthy shops